The image shows a detailed close-up of the facade of the Barcelona Cathedral, located in the Gothic Quarter of Barcelona, Spain. The focus is on the elaborate stonework of an entrance, featuring multiple recessed arches that are intricately decorated. Each arch is lined with small, sculpted figures that appear to be angels or saints, perched on decorative corbels. Above the arches, the facade displays complex Gothic tracery, with geometric patterns and quatrefoil motifs carved into the stone. A rose window with delicate stone mullions and tinted glass is visible within the central arch. The stonework is weathered and has a warm, sandy-beige hue, suggesting it is made of sandstone or a similar material. The lighting indicates it is daytime, with shadows cast by the architectural elements, highlighting the depth and texture of the carvings.
